When I read the blurb I got very interested in the story, as I had a similar idea on my mind for a while.
Sadly this book didn't live up to my expectations. The conflict between the older, peaceful species and their more aggressive new comers seems to be mostly a side note, mostly reduced to the typical civilian/politicians vs. Military stereotypes.
Now I have to mention that I still enjoyed reading it, as it is written quite well. The twist, without spoiling is prepared, hinted on without being completely obvious till it becomes necessary, so it doesn't get boring. But overall it just comes a tiny bit to short in character development and to shallow on the universe it plays in.
Even though I didn't feel I could honestly give more than three stars,I'm definitely going to give the next book in the series a try, as the potential is there.
If you enjoy military sci-fi, you probably will enjoy this book too.
